Aldi Satya Mahendra Makes History as Indonesia’s First WorldSSP 300 Champion

Jakarta, Indonesia Sentinel — Indonesia has a new reason to celebrate in the world of international motorcycle racing, as Aldi Satya Mahendra has secured the WorldSSP 300 championship title. The young rider from Yogyakarta achieved this remarkable feat in his debut season in the WorldSSP 300, the entry-level class of the World Superbike Championship (WSBK) series.

Aldi’s exceptional performance throughout the season, marked by consistent podium finishes, propelled him to the top of the championship standings. The WorldSSP 300, often compared to Moto3 in MotoGP, serves as a proving ground for young riders before advancing to higher levels of competition.

Over the course of 15 races in eight rounds, Aldi managed to secure top-three finishes in eight races. His first victory came in the second race at Misano, setting the tone for his championship campaign.

In the season’s final round held in Jerez, Spain, on Saturday, October 20, 2024, Aldi finished third in the first race. This result solidified his lead in the standings, with a total of 211 points, placing him 22 points ahead of his closest competitor, Loris Veneman of the MTM Kawasaki team. Veneman, who finished sixth after receiving a penalty for reckless riding, could no longer threaten Aldi’s lead, even with one race remaining.

With a maximum of 25 points still available, Aldi only needed to finish 12th or better in the second race to secure the world title. This gave him ample room to race strategically and clinch the championship with minimal pressure.

Riding a Yamaha YZF-R3 for Team BrCorse Yamaha, Aldi couldn’t hide his joy after securing the title. In a post-race interview, he expressed his gratitude, saying, “This is incredible for me, as it’s been my dream to become a world champion. I gave my best in this race. Thanks to my team for their hard work, and I’ll try to play it safe in the next race. I’m also grateful to my family and girlfriend for their support.”

Aldi’s historic victory makes him the first Indonesian rider to win an international motorcycle racing world championship, a dream come true for many young racers in the country. His success brings renewed hope and attention to Indonesia’s burgeoning motorsport scene.

Aldi, the younger brother of Galang Hendra Pratama, another Indonesian international racer, has now paved the way for the next generation of Indonesian riders. He has shown that with hard work, determination, and strong support, becoming a world champion is an achievable goal.

The second and final race of the WorldSSP 300 season at Jerez, scheduled for Sunday, October 20, 2024, will provide Aldi the chance to cap off his championship-winning season in style.
